Methods, Systems and Devices for Activity Tracking Device Data Synchronization With Computing Devices
First Claim
1. A method, comprising,capturing activity data associated with an activity of a user via a device, the activity data being captured over a period of time, the activity data quantified by a plurality of metrics;
- storing the activity data in a storage of the device;
connecting the device with a computing device over a wireless communication link;
using a first transfer rate for transferring the activity data captured and stored over the period of time, the first transfer rate used following startup of an activity tracking application on the computing device; and
using a second transfer rate for transferring the activity data from the device to the computing device for display of the activity data in substantial-real time on the computing device, the method is executed by a processor.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ods, devices and system are provided. One method includes capturing activity data associated with activity of a user via a device. The activity data is captured over time, and the activity data is quantifiable by a plurality of metrics. The method includes storing the activity data in storage of the device and, from time to time, connecting the device with a computing device over a wireless communication link. The method defines using a first transfer rate for transferring activity data captured and stored over a period of time. The first transfer rate is used following startup of an activity tracking application on the computing device The method also defines using a second transfer rate for transferring activity data from the device to the computing device for display of the activity data in substantial-real time on the computing device.
20 Citations
30 Claims
-
1. A method, comprising,
capturing activity data associated with an activity of a user via a device, the activity data being captured over a period of time, the activity data quantified by a plurality of metrics; -
storing the activity data in a storage of the device; connecting the device with a computing device over a wireless communication link; using a first transfer rate for transferring the activity data captured and stored over the period of time, the first transfer rate used following startup of an activity tracking application on the computing device; and using a second transfer rate for transferring the activity data from the device to the computing device for display of the activity data in substantial-real time on the computing device, the method is executed by a processor.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A device configured for capture of activity for a user, comprising,
a housing; -
a sensor disposed in the housing to capture activity data associated with activity of the user; a memory for storing the captured activity data; and a processor for managing connection of the device with a computing device over a wireless communication link, the processor configured to use a first transfer rate for transferring activity data captured and stored in the memory of the device, and configured to use a second transfer rate for transferring activity data for display in substantial-real time on the computing device as the sensor captures the activity data.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23)
-
-
24. A method, comprising,
capturing activity data associated with activity of a user via a device, the activity data being captured over a period of time, the activity data quantified by a plurality of metrics and storing the activity data in a storage of the device; -
connecting the device to a computing device over a wireless communication link; setting a data transfer rate between the device and the computing device, the transfer rate being one of a first transfer rate for transferring activity data captured and stored over the period of time or a second transfer rate for transferring activity data that is displayable in substantial-real time on the computing device; and transferring the activity data from the device to the computing device at the selected first or second transfer rate; wherein the first transfer rate is set in response to scaling-up a connection interval and the second transfer rate is set in response to scaling-down the connection interval, the method is executed by a processor. - View Dependent Claims (25, 26, 27, 28)
-
-
29. A computer readable medium for storing program instructions executable by a processor, the computer readable medium comprising,
program instructions for capturing activity data associated with activity of a user via a device, the activity data being captured over a period of time, the activity data quantified by a plurality of metrics and storing the activity data in a storage of the device; -
program instructions for connecting the device to a computing device over a wireless communication link; program instructions for setting a data transfer rate between the device and the computing device, the transfer rate being one of a first transfer rate for transferring activity data captured and stored over the period of time or a second transfer rate for transferring activity data that is displayable in substantial-real time on the computing device; and program instructions for transferring the activity data from the device to the computing device at the selected first or second transfer rate; wherein the first transfer rate is set in response to scaling-up a connection interval and the second transfer rate is set in response to scaling-down the connection interval, the method is executed by a processor. - View Dependent Claims (30)
-
Specification